Rice Hulls & Rice Husk Ash


Rice hull, also known as rice husk, is the hard outer shell of rice grains removed during milling. It is rich in organic fiber and carbon, making it suitable for livestock feed, eco-friendly biomass fuel, and industrial raw materials. Our rice hulls (husk) availlable:


Rice Husk, which is the hard outer shell of rice grains, rich in organic fiber. With an organic carbon content of approximately 30–50%, it is widely used for livestock feed, biomass fuel, and eco-friendly industrial materials.


Rice Husk Powder, a finely ground form of husk with a flour-like texture. It serves multiple purposes such as adhesive for plywood, insect repellent coils, and other industrial chemical mixtures.


Rice Husk Dust is an ultra-fine, lightweight powder derived from ground husk. With porous and insulating properties, it is commonly used as a filler material, thermal insulation, and soil enhancer in agriculture.

Rice Husk Ash (RHA), a combustion by-product of rice husk with high silica content. RHA is available in three variants based on carbon and silica levels:


  • Low (≤ 2.5% carbon, ≥ 90% silica)
  • Normal (5–15% carbon, ≥ 80% silica)
  • High (≥ 40% carbon, ≤ 60% silica)
